College football fans searching for games on Saturday, August 22, will have to wait one more week for the FBS season to begin.

There are no FBS college football games scheduled for today, August 22. The 2026 FBS season kicks off Saturday, August 29 with Week 0, an eight-game slate stretching from North Carolina-TCU at noon ET through Memphis-UNLV at 10 p.m. ET.

That makes August 22 the final Saturday without FBS football before the season gets underway.


When Does College Football Start in 2026?

The first FBS games of the 2026 college football season are scheduled for Saturday, August 29.

Week 0 is the smaller opening slate that precedes the traditional Labor Day weekend launch. The first full week of the season begins Thursday, September 3, with most teams opening on Saturday, September 5.

For fans waiting to see ranked teams, Power Four programs and familiar national names, however, August 29 will already offer plenty to watch.

North Carolina and TCU open the FBS schedule at noon ET in Dublin, Ireland. Bill Belichick’s Tar Heels will be looking for a dramatically different result after TCU beat North Carolina 48-14 in Chapel Hill in Belichick’s debut last season.

USC, Florida State, Stanford, Virginia and NC State are also part of the opening-day schedule.


College Football Week 0 Schedule: August 29

Here is the FBS lineup currently scheduled for the first Saturday of the 2026 season. All times are Eastern.

North Carolina vs. TCU — 12 p.m., ESPN
The game will be played at Aviva Stadium in Dublin as part of the Aer Lingus College Football Classic.

San Jose State at No. 14 USC — 3 p.m., NBC
USC begins its season at the Los Angeles Memorial Coliseum after entering the preseason AP Top 25 at No. 14.

NC State at Virginia — 3:30 p.m., ESPN
The ACC opponents meet immediately rather than waiting for conference play later in the season.

Jacksonville State at North Dakota State — 5:30 p.m., CBS Sports Network

Sacramento State at Eastern Michigan — 6:30 p.m., ESPN+

New Mexico State at Florida State — 7 p.m., The CW

Hawaii at Stanford — 7 p.m., ACC Network

Memphis at UNLV — 10 p.m., FOX

The schedule gives fans FBS football from noon until late Saturday night, with games available across ESPN, NBC, CBS Sports Network, ESPN+, The CW, ACC Network and FOX.


When Is the First Full Saturday of College Football?

Week 0 gets the season started, but Saturday, September 5 is when the college football calendar expands dramatically.

Among the notable Week 1 games are Clemson-LSU, Boise State-Oregon, Colorado-Georgia Tech, Baylor-Auburn and Louisville-Ole Miss. Wisconsin and Notre Dame follow on Sunday in Green Bay.

That weekend will also bring the first games for many preseason contenders.

Ohio State enters the season ranked No. 1 in the AP poll, followed by Oregon, Georgia, Notre Dame and Texas. The SEC placed nine teams in the preseason Top 25, while Ohio State and Oregon gave the Big Ten the nation’s top two teams.

So while there isn’t FBS college football to watch on August 22, the wait is nearly over.

Week 0 begins August 29, the full opening week follows over Labor Day weekend, and college football Saturdays are officially one week away.
